Having fun playing the Star Wars Battlefront beta? If so, you’ll be happy to know that the beta end date has been extended! Instead of ending on October 12, the Star Wars Battlefront beta end date will now be on October 13! Yep, it’s just a day, I know, but it’s better than nothing, right?

Here’s the complete blog post by Battlefront Community Manager Matt Everette:

Hope you’re enjoying the Star Wars Battlefront beta and thank you for playing – every time you log on, it’s helping us ensure the experience is going to be great at launch. As we get into the late stages of the beta, we will begin conducting further technical tests on our infrastructure.

These additional tests will start on Monday, October 12 and will run thru Tuesday, October 13th, which will add an additional day to the open Beta. These tests are to help us find some extreme scenarios, and that means some players may experience occasional issues such as being kicked from the game or losing connectivity. This is all being done in the name of shoring up our infrastructure before we launch on November 17th.

Please continue to provide your feedback around the Beta and we look forward to seeing you on the battlefront in November.
